Into The Pool
Scott Ballard
United States, 2026, 9 min.
In English.
This film is family friendly.
In her mid-seventies, synchronized swimmer Julie Vigeland continues to find herself in the pool - a place where aging dissolves into a dance of healing, connection and joy.
Director's Statement
Julie leads us into her personal story with water and synchronized swimming, one that speaks to a universal love of creative expression and a new perspective of what aging in sports can look like.
